Ranaan Meyer, bass "Ranaan Meyer makes the double bass sound like it was meant to be a solo instrument." (Peter Dobrin, The Philadelphia Inquirer) Meyer is best known for the groundbreaking string trio Time for Three, with whom he has performed across the country, and for his solo bass performances and fresh compositional style. Always on the cutting edge, Meyer now captivates with another vibrant ensemble creating new, poly-stylistic repertoire and featuring pianist Norma Meyer (Piano 4) and others.
